Chief Minister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Sohail Afridi ended his sit-in outside Adiala Jail, which had been going on since yesterday, and left for the Islamabad High Court.

Chief Minister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Afridi had been continuously protesting against the lack of a meeting with the founder of PTI. The Chief Minister had demanded a meeting with the founder of PTI, but despite of his eighth attempt, he was not successful. After the Chief Minister’s continuous refusal to meet, Chief Minister Afridi staged a sit-in outside the jail, where PTI workers were also accompanied him in chilly weather.

Talking to the media at Gorakhpur checkpoint, Chief Minister Sohail Afridi said that the night was spent here with our workers, it was just one night, even if he had to spend his whole life here for the founder of PTI, he would spend it. He said that he has not yet been informed about the well-being of the PTI founder, which is causing serious concern among the workers. He said that their training is such that they will not back down from sit-ins, protests and our demands.

After ending the sit-in, the Chief Minister of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a left for the Islamabad High Court, where he will review the legal progress regarding the PTI founder. It may be recalled that Chief Minister of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Sohail Afridi had written a letter to the Chief Justice of the Islamabad High Court regarding the issue of not allowing the PTI founder to meet him in jail.

In the letter, Chief Minister of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Sohail Afridi requested to provide a certified copy of the court order. Adiala Jail officials said that Chief Minister Sohail Afridi cannot meet PTI founder due to lack of a certified copy of the court order.
